mcole@scotty (COLE) writes:
: I am having trouble driving a stepper motor.  I am driving each of the  
: phases with an IRF510 FET.  At around 1KHz the motor just sits there and  
: hums.  Any suggestions?
Well is it a Bipolar stepper? Are you using a high side driver chip? Do
you have access to a scope? Are you using a current chopper? If not what
is your load resistor? And what is your power supply voltage? And what is
the current rating per phase on the motor?
